Tachyon Project first released over 2 years ago and is currently available on PC (Steam), Wii U, Xbox One, PS4 and PS Vita. Switch will join the rooster on January the 25th, 2018. Anyway, this version has been improved and treated with extra care to try to fix most of the issues highlighted by reviews and users on the original.

This is the definitive edition of Tachyon Project. We should've added it to the title we just didn't think of it at the time. Here you have some of the additions to this new version:
Improved visuals, particularly in the menus.
Support for local multiplayer in story mode (while you could only play local coop in the Challenges).
Improved enemy creation FX to make it clearer and avoid 'cheap deaths'.
Redesigned many of the first few levels to make them a little bit more interesting.
Now let me add a few words about the game to refresh your memory on what Tachyon Project is:

Tachyon Project is an action-packed dual-stick shooter where we've taken concepts from the classic shoot'em up genre and adapted them. The player will find the gameplay versatility and speed traditional to dual-stick shooters but with the weapons and enemies diversity normally found in shoot'em ups, providing a more varied and interesting gameplay. But gameplay innovations are not limited to weapon and enemy design but you'll also be able to play a new stealth game mode.

In Tachyon Project you take control of Ada, a software program design to hack into the most secure servers in the world. After some rather mysterious events, Ada is thrown out into the internet and she'll have to fight to uncover the truth about her creators' disappearance.

The narrative is presented through 10 unique levels, each made of 6 progressively challenging waves. Success is rewarded with new weapons and perks that are essential to aid you against increasingly difficult odds and tougher enemies.

Features:
Story-driven, action-packed dual-stick shooter
6 different weapons, 9 secondary weapons, and 7 perks provide hundreds of combinations for your ship
Over 30 different enemy types, including 4 bosses
Over 60 different waves in the 10 levels that comprise story mode
Innovative stealth gameplay levels and health system
Up to 4 players local multiplayer
An interesting story, told through hand-drawn cutscenes, drives the gameplay
An intense original soundtrack by Tyson Prince, Kevin Murphy, and Toni Ros
Tachyon Project is available on Nintendo Switch for $9.99/€9.99/£7.99.
